Wellington New Zealand -Syllable Pyramidal Challenge

Here

This place

Heavy with rain

Wind cascaded

Small of populace

Lofty hillside grandeur

Beehive, Zoo and cable car

Botanic Gardens and the like

Karori Sanctuary with the birds

St Gerard’s Cathedral oriental bay

Cafes, takeaways, steakhouses, diners and caravans

Bakeries and delicatessens

Warehouse bargains guaranteed

Bucket fountain Cuba mall

Where earthquakes kick ass

Harbour City

Wellington

My home

Here
